    This project came out as good as I could expect. I've attached the mpc, you're welcome to use it.

    I designed and carved this one before I had my pattern editor installed, so the project came out with the stair-stepping on the oval as shown on the mpc. A little sanding, and the steps cleaned up. After installing the editor, it cleaned up those flaws just fine in designer.
